Exceptional customer service has become one of the strongest competitive advantages a business can have. While products and prices can often be matched by competitors, consistently delivering outstanding customer experiences helps organizations build loyalty, increase customer retention, and strengthen their reputation.
Whether you work in retail, healthcare, hospitality, financial services, call centers, or technology, strong customer service skills are valuable in virtually every industry. Effective customer service professionals know how to communicate clearly, resolve complaints, build trust, and create positive experiences that encourage customers to return.
Organizations also recognize the value of investing in customer service training. According to PwC's Future of Customer Experience Survey, 73% of consumers say customer experience is an important factor in their purchasing decisions, yet many believe companies still fall short of meeting expectations. Developing customer service skills can help businesses close that gap while improving customer satisfaction and long-term loyalty.

How to Choose the Right Customer Service Course
The right course depends on your career goals and current responsibilities.
If you're entering customer service for the first time, a fundamentals course can help you build confidence in communication, professionalism, and problem-solving.
If you already work in customer support, consider expanding your knowledge through customer experience, customer success, analytics, or leadership training.
When comparing programs, consider:
- Your experience level
- Course length
- Certificate availability
- Industry relevance
- Instructor or provider reputation
- Career goals
- Whether you prefer a single course or a Professional Certificate
Choosing a course that aligns with your current role will help you apply your new skills more quickly in the workplace.
